About Us

Rooted in sustainability and driven by design excellence, Cornerstone Timberframes is a family-owned leader in mass timber and timber frame design. From modern commercial and public spaces, custom homes and heritage-inspired builds to, our passionate team blends timeless craftsmanship with cutting-edge innovation to deliver projects that truly stand out

The Role: Commercial Project Coordinator

Reporting directly to the Commercial Project Manager.
